Illinois is adding a bit of running back depth in time for the Michigan game.

Prior to this season, running back Chase Brown transferred to Illinois after spending his freshman season with Western Michigan. On Saturday, Illinois Football announced that Brown has been granted his immediate eligibility after filing an appeal.

Brown rushed for 352 yards and appeared in 13 games for the Broncos as a freshman. Considering Illinois is missing Mike Epstein for the season, having Brown is a nice depth boost in time for a tough game.
